Getting Started BC Basic Media Player 1.4 Power On The BC Basic requires +12V dc to both the red and yellow wires. When both of these wires have power, the BC Basic is always powered on and is indicated by a red LED coming out of the heatsink of the stereo. Ground is connected to the Black wire. In a SPA application, this requires the red and yellow wires to be jumped together and tehn connected to +12V dc output of the power source.

Additonal Features 3.1 BC Basic Media Player Connecting Multiple Amplifiers or High Current Draw Lighting Systems Wiring a Single Pole Single Throw (SPST) Relay The SPST is necessary to protect the stereo in systems with multiple amplifiers. The AQ-BC-6UBT remote and trigger wire provide 2A max current. While this is enough to power a single amplifier, complex systems with multiple amplifiers will require a SPST relay. Position 30: requires 12VDC from the main power source (12V battery, power supply etc).
